Quick Assessment

This early reader adaptation of the classic tale The Three Little Pigs features familiar characters and themes of problem-solving and cooperation. Designed for ages 5-8 and grade 2 reading level, it introduces young readers to narrative structure and vocabulary through engaging illustrations and interactive storytelling. Parents should note the story includes mild conflict as Pig's houses are knocked down, resolved with teamwork and communication.
